Jameson in Multi-Year Deal as Official Spirits Sponsor of NFL
Jameson has entered a major multiyear partnership as the Official Spirits Sponsor of the NFL, expanding its commitment to sports fandom and gameday rituals starting this fall.

Palm Bay International Announces New Distributor Deals Across 26 States
Palm Bay International, which announced a strategic partnership with Republic National Distributing Co. in April 2024, said it signed with Southern Glazer's Wine & Spirits in 15 states and Reyes Beverage Group for 11 states. SGWS already represents Palm Bay in six states.
